An Exciting New Star Wars Show Is Rumored To Be In Development From Dave Filoni and Jon Favreau

A new rumor suggests that Jon Favreau and Dave Filoni are working on another Star Wars show!
disney star wars - the mandalorian

Star Wars is gearing up to have a monster of a year, with The Bad Batch, The Mandalorian, Skeleton Crew, and Ahsoka all hitting Disney+ in 2023. Needless to say, Jon Favreau and Dave Filoni have their hands full as they continue ushering in a new era for the global franchise.

According to a new rumor from Daniel Richtman, the creative duo is adding another series to their long list of Star Wars projects.

STAR WARS COULD ADD ANOTHER SHOW TO ITS JAM-PACKED GALAXY

According to Richtman’s report (via SFF Gazette), Dave Filoni and Jon Favreau are already hard at work on another, brand-new Star Wars Disney+ television show. The report doesn’t suggest what the show will focus on, but it’s in the early stages of production. However, we could be looking at another spinoff of The Mandalorian, Ahsoka, or just a completely new idea.

Richtman’s report does include a codename for the series, “Ghost Track 17,” but that more than likely has nothing to do with the subject of the show. If the rumor turns out to be accurate, Favreau and Filoni could look to Star Wars Celebration Europe 2023 to make an official announcement on the upcoming project.

Favreau and Filoni have worked together on all the live-action Star Wars projects since the Disney+ era of the franchise began. Favreau’s priorities seem to mainly focus on The Mandalorian, while Filoni prioritized the live-action Ahsoka series and the animation department.

Assuming the creative duo continues their current trend, one would expect the new mystery show to take place in the newly-established Mandalorian time period, which is set after The Return of the Jedi and the fall of the Empire. It seems the two Star Wars legends want to fully flesh out the post-Return of the Jedi pre-The Force Awakens period in the franchise’s history.

THE FUTURE OF STAR WARS IS IN GOOD HANDS

Following the less-than-ideal conclusion of the Skywalker Saga with Star Wars: Episode 9 – The Rise of Skywalker, the future of the franchise looked grim. However, everything changed once The Mandalorian hit Disney+ in the fall of 2019.

The brainchild of Jon Favreau and Dave Filoni revitalized the franchise, bringing in a roster of new and returning characters for the space western. The Mandalorian’s success proved that the franchise still had more to offer, and the creative duo quickly began working on several spinoffs.

Jon Favreau and Dave Filoni laughing

Since then, Favreau and Filoni have created two seasons of The Mandalorian and a spinoff, The Book of Boba Fett. Lucasfilm announced a second spinoff, Rangers of the New Republic, but they quickly axed the show after firing actress Gina Carano over insensitive social media posts. Ahsoka and Skeleton Crew later joined the roster of Disney+ shows, and both premiere on the streaming service this year, along with The Mandalorian Season 3.

Many fans hope for an eventual crossover for all of these shows taking place at the same time. Favreau alluded to that possibility at Star Wars Celebration, telling Steele Wars Ahsoka and Mando Season 3 start to “get deeper into characters that have connections with other characters of importance.”
